- British Columbia will extend provincial sales tax (PST) to certain professional services starting October 1, 2026.
- Affected services include accounting, architectural, engineering, geoscience, security, and various non-residential real estate services.
- Businesses will face new compliance obligations and unrecoverable PST costs.
- Further details and regulations will be released by the province at a later date.
